WebbA noun is a word that represents a person, thing, concept, or place. Most sentences contain at least one noun or pronoun. For example, the sentences below contain anywhere from one to three nouns. Examples: Nouns in a sentence The dog ran very fast. June is my favorite month. Teachers emphasize the importance of grammar.
